What Is an LLM.txt File?
An LLM.txt file tells AI systems how to interpret, summarise, or reference your website’s content. It’s similar to a robots.txt file, but designed for Large Language Models (LLMs) — the technology behind tools like ChatGPT, Claude, and Gemini.
In simple terms:
It helps AI know which parts of your site are accurate, relevant, and safe to use in AI-generated answers.
A well-structured LLM.txt file can help your business appear more clearly in AI-driven search results — a growing part of how people discover information online.

How to Create an LLM.txt File
1. Create a Plain Text File
Open a blank text document and name it:
llm.txt
Save it in your website’s root folder, the same place your robots.txt lives. Example:https://www.yoursite.com/llm.txt
2. Add Basic Access Instructions
Here’s a simple version that gives AI tools permission to read your public pages:
User-agent: *
Allow: /
Disallow: /admin/
Policy: public
Contact: https://www.yoursite.com/contact
Updated: 2025-10-10
This tells AI systems:
They can use your main content
They should ignore admin or private areas
They have a way to contact you if needed
3. Add Optional Details for Clarity
You can include extra context to help AI understand your site:
Description: Official website of Smith Web Design, providing digital design and SEO services in Manchester.
Copyright: © 2025 Smith Web Design Ltd. All rights reserved.
Attribution: Required
These fields help AI tools reference your business correctly and give proper credit.
4. Keep It Up to Date
Review your LLM.txt file every few months or after major site changes.If your business description, contact page, or content focus changes, update it.
Example LLM.txt Template
You can copy and paste this version and update it for your business:
User-agent: *
Allow: /
Disallow: /admin/
Policy: public
Contact: https://www.yoursite.com/contact
Description: [Brief description of your business and website focus]
Copyright: © [Year] [Business Name]. All rights reserved.
Attribution: Required
Sitemap: https://www.yoursite.com/sitemap.xml
Updated: [Date]
